A chasm trap occurs when two manytoone joins converge on a single table, and the query includes. With missing tables one cant practice chasm trap, fan trap and other examples in the book. A fan trap is many many relationship 3 or more then three tables are involved. Resolving fan traps in sap bo resolving fan traps in sap bo courses with reference manuals and examples pdf. A few days ago i finally got started on what will become a series of posts about fan and chasm traps. I tried reading on the following terms but i am still not clear on it. Resolving fan traps in sap bo tutorial 24 april 2020 learn. Fan trap occur in a situation when a model represents relationship between entity types however a path between certain entity occurrences is ambiguous. The query information is passed to other system using cwxml common warehouse xml files this makes query data interoperable to desperate systems requiring various different software. Sounds like one of those metal claws hunters put in the jungle to capture leopards and panthers not something you want to fall into around the office. We will then notify you when a course has been scheduled.
Similarly is there any way we can find chasm or fan traps. Again like chasm trap you have to create two separate queries to display correct result. For example when you run a query that asks for the total orders by each order line, for a particular. A fan trap simply means you are defining and using measures from two parts of a onetomany join. Training for analytics with business intelligence bi in. Review of the fan trap and chasm trap in entityrelationship diagramming and how to assess whether a potentially redundant connection in an er diagram is in fact required or not. Thus, the condition of a chasm trap should be avoidedresolved. Many to one joins from two fact tables converge on a single lookup table. Therefore you can actually have a fan trap with only two tables. The database mentioned on the website is missing tables and customer service wont reply to email. In france over the past twenty years gnp has grown by 80 per cent, 6 a spectacular performance. Fan trap the fan trap occurs when a one to many join links a table which is in turn linked by another one to many join. Fan trap and chasm trap this is an example of fan trap and chasm trap and how to resolve these scenarios. Business objects interview questions and answers business.
The book has a very practical approach towards universe concepts but without the underlying database its useless to buy this book. It can cause numbers to multiply it gives inflated results when u pull data from these tables. The following brief explanation may help you in understanding the concept which is usually found to be dubious across the web. Like in case of loops when we detect loops in the universe it tells us n loops detected. The door must be opened through afterlife before the trap can be used. Like the below example, general ledger gl is joined with gl balance fact and loan balance fact tables in many ends. It is located in the doorway that leads to the wardens office. A chasm trap is simply one specific way that tables in a database schema can be related to one another. Sap business objects is a business intelligence tool that provides the combination of analysis, reporting and querying intended to find instant answers to the businessrelated questions and help management improve their decisionmaking process. A chasm occurs when a series of joins crosses a many one a b. Recognizing and resolving chasm and fan traps when designing universes. This is the most effective way to solve the fan trap problem. Select the first link draw the diagram of the join as it is seen in the bo designer andsee if there is any fanchasm trap or not.
The solution is to adjust your er model like the following shown in only the crows foot notation with the fan trap above and the remodelled version below which resolves the trap. Recognizing and resolving chasm and fan traps when. Training for analytics with business intelligence bi in sap. When a one to many join linked by another one to many join in a serious of tables called as fan trap. A chasm trap is a type of join path between three tables when two manytoone joins converge on a single table, and there is no context in place that separates the converging join paths. The fan trap occurs when a one to many join links a table which is in turn linked by. The data source or the query is known as the data provider. Part 6 fan trap sap business objects tutorial bobj 4. Chasm traps in universes business one community wiki. And yet during this same period unemployment has grown from 420,000 people to 5. Top 20 business objects interview questions and answers pdf.
And why does it strike fear in the hearts of data analysts everywhere. It does take a structural understanding of the data and more importantly how the user community will consume the data to provide objects to avoid these scenarios. For the utility in zetsubou no shima, see fan trap black ops iii the fan trap is a utility featured in the zombies map mob of the dead. There are lot of opportunities from many reputed companies in the world. Apr 16, 2020 best sap bo interview questions and answers. A fan trap is solved by creating an alias of the 2nd table and defining contexts such that, the 14. I have a fan trap using po header, po lines and po distributions which has been resolved using alias tables. To take a step back, in a denormalized data model, you have fact and dimension tables. A fan trap occurs in one many many relationship and chasm trap occurs in many one relationship.
You should set teh display as the arity in the tooloptions graphics. According to research business objects has a market share of about 5. Now you can create the report and it will create separate sql for each context and data will get synchronized based on common dimension customer. Sap bo interview questions for freshers experienced. This blog post is about describing the fan trap and the chasm trap and how these should be handled in a qlik data model. It occurs when an er diagram suggests the existence of a relationship between entity sets, but in reality, the connection does not exist. Free hand sql personal data files stored procedures vb macros olap date formula format date todate,yyyymmdd,ddmmyyyy usersgeneral supervisor supervisor designer supervisor designer user versatile user bca scheduling the reports hourly daily weekly monthly general actions categories scheduling distribution send to bca. This list of interview questions includes the various types of connections, custom hierarchies, schemas supported by business objects designer, data sources and more. Chasm trap and fan traps are the loops which will occur while ditecting loops. Context is formed when the dimension objects are available in one or both fact. The term fan trap helps in one to many joining links which further take action with another one to many joining links. It has the same effect of returning more data than expected. The best business objects interview questions updated 2020. Using an alias and the aggregate awareness function.
Recognizing and resolving chasm and fan traps when designing universes relational databases can return incorrect results due to limitations in the way that joins are performed in relational databases. Example of how the fantraps and chasm traps works answer abdul. This is a join path problem that is created in a universe. Hi, there is one pdf document provided by bo, on the traps at this link trap document. How we will see which trapchasm trap or fantrap was used in. As we said,using aggregate awareness we can resolve this issue. Chasm trap the chasm trap occurs when two many to one joins converge on a single table.
There is one pdf document provided by bo, on the traps at this link trap document. In fact there are many fan traps that can occur in a universe design that can be ignored as long as you control which types of objects you use. There are multiple join paths to go from time entries to clients and hence the prompt. Instead if you had added time entries, expense sheets and then clients, it would know that both of those join paths are required and will not prompt. A fan trap is a join between 3 tables where a onetomany join links the first table to the second and another onetomany join links the second table to the third. Inflated results are obtained when fields from all 3 tables are included in the query.
A fan trap is a less common problem than chasm traps but has the same effect of returning more data than expected. Luckily for those of us who deal with data on a daily basis, these traps are a lot less deadly but not by much. For example a customer can place many ordersand or place many loans. The fan trap occurs when a one to many join links a table which is in turn linked by another one to many join.
Bca is a software product for the users of webi and bo to process and distribute documents automatically at the scheduled dates and time. The chasm trap occurs when two many to one joins converge on a single table. In bi system fan trap and chasm trap are common problem when designing a universe semantic layer which is used by bi reports to dynamically generate query. Fact tables contain measurable business facts like sales or order records and references to dimension tables, which contain details about the entities. So to answer your question, you can have a wrong sql statement leading to a fan trap results or to a chasm trap results even if you write it in a query tool. It occurs where there is a relationship with partial participation, which forms part of the pathway between entities that are related. Creating an alias and applying aggregate awareness function. However, it also mentioned that the basic solution would not work in most cases, and that contexts would be required for a more complete solution.
Top business objects interview questions and answers for 2020. Recognizing and resolving chasm and fan traps when designing. How do you go about resolving a chasm trap caused by a many to many relationship in your data where using normal table joins creates a partial cartesian product in tableau. Aug 25, 20 the database mentioned on the website is missing tables and customer service wont reply to email. The chasm trap shows you misleading figures in the report which can impact management decision making.
When two many to one joins converge on a single table is called chasm trap and there should be many to one to many join relation between 3 three tables. The problem i am having is applying conditions at the po distribution level. We are in chasm trap when a table joins with two others in onetomany relationship. Bo designer free download as powerpoint presentation. Resolving fan traps in sap bo tutorial 24 april 2020. Business object can be considered as integrated analysis, reporting and query for the purpose of finding a solution to some business professionals that can be helpful for them to retrieve data from the corporate databases in a direct manner from the desktop.
Unlike loops, which return fewer rows, the chasm and. The image on this page were taken in the desktop version of sisense, however, the same principles described on this page also apply to the webbased elasticube manager chasm and fan traps should be avoided when building your elasticube schemas chasm traps. Chasm trap should be solved by making use of two di. Fan trap occur in a situation when a model represents relationship between entity types however a path between certain entity occurrences is ambiguous example. A fan trap is a less common problem than chasm traps in a relational database schema. Dec 04, 2019 top business objects interview questions and answers here we have compiled the top sap business objects interview questions and answers to help you in your job interview. Since bo is creating multiple queries for header and distribution data, the condition on distribution will not be applied to the header query. If the question is does designer detect fan traps and chasms automatically the answer is no. Aug 31, 2014 in bi system fan trap and chasm trap are common problem when designing a universe semantic layer which is used by bi reports to dynamically generate query. A chasm trap occurs when a model suggests the existence of a relationship between entity types, but the pathway does not exist between certain entity occurrences. A chasm trap is a common problem in relational database schemas in which a join path returns more data than expected. Rebuild worksheet for fan trap and chasm trap questions.
Please feel free to register interest for this course on sap training. Select the first link draw the diagram of the join as it is seen in the bo designer andsee if there is any fan chasm trap or not. Nbranch in this model it may be impossible to determine the branch a staff belongs to, in the situation when staff belong to division having more than 1 branches. Chasm trap is a condition that arises when the values inside the fact table get in. This type of fanning out of one to many joins is called a fan trap. Aug 27, 2014 while designing sap businessobjects universe with universe design tool, chasm trap is one of the major join problems that one can come across. Sep 29, 2014 such a condition is known as a fan trap. In my universe when i do a integrity check it gives me following result20 1. The query information is passed to other system using cwxml common warehouse xml files this makes query data interoperable to desperate systems requiring various different software landscape. Resolving chasm traps in sap bo tutorial 22 april 2020. Boe310 sap businessobjects business intelligence platform.
Can anyone help explain and give examples on what a fan trap and. A model suggests the existence of a relationship between entity types, but the pathway does not exist between certain entity occurrences. If i were to write a query that spanned all three of those tables the data from table a and c would be duplicated and measure values would be inflated. Mark ferris this is more because of the order in which you are adding the tables. Reports created on universes having chasm traps tend to give incorrect results. While designing sap businessobjects universe with universe design tool, chasm trap is one of the major join problems that one can come across we are in chasm trap when a table joins with two others in onetomany relationship. A fan trap is a type of join path between three tables when a onetomany join links a table which is in turn linked by another onetomany join. Nbranch in this model it may be impossible to determine the branch a staff belongs to, in the situation when staff belong to division. The player can evade the fans while they are spinning by crawling under them. Daves adventures in business intelligence fan chasm trap. Its not because bo is not clever enough, its because a universe developer did not solve traps so heshe tells bo to generate such statements. A one to many join links to a table which respond with another one to many join links is called fan trap. Resolving chasm traps in tableau tableau community forums.
I wanted to know how to identify whether your universe contains chasm or fan traps. Administration and security there are currently no events available for this course. This type of join convergence is called a chasm trap. Scribd is the worlds largest social reading and publishing site. The fan trap is resolved by restructuring the original er model to represent the correct association. A one to many join links a table which is in turn linked by a one to many join. Fan trap it occurs when a one to many join links a table which is in turn linked by another one to many join. Create two sql statements by checking on the option of multiple sql statements for each measure.
Interview questions and answers free pdf download page 14 of 51 normal table is joined only with the first table, while the alias is joined with both the 1st and the 3rd table. Top 31 most important sap bo interview questions and answers. The most common problem caused by a chasm trap is fetching more data than expected. Go to universe parameters sql multiple paths check the options multiple sql statements for each context and multiple sql statements.
328 1308 1093 905 309 393 396 615 975 529 826 269 1098 338 1540 915 893 52 1545 1380 1251 396 1479 1238 49 349 903 1549 962 1193 624 1470 530 917 1264 1275 450 1291 351 240 377 391 782 938